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center, 836 West Wellington Ave, Chicago, IL 60657

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center is located on Chicago’s North Side. It is one of the state’s largest, most comprehensive nonprofit medical centers. The hospital has many specialties.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center is part of Advocate Health Care, the largest fully integrated health system in Illinois.

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center provides acute care as well as emergency department services. The hospital participates in nursing care registry, multispecialty surgical registry and general surgery registry.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center is able to track patients’ lab results, tests and referrals electronically between visits.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center uses outpatient and inpatient safe surgery checklists. The overall rating for the hospital has two stars out of five.

Based on the survey of patients’ experiences, the patient survey summary gives the hospital three stars out of five. Patients at the hospital who reported that their nurses “always” communicated well, stands at 79%. The Illinois and national averages are both 80%.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center patients reported that their doctors “always” communicated well at the rate of 79%. 74% of who were surveyed said that they would definitely recommend the hospital to other patients. 71% is the average of patients who reported that they would definitely recommend the hospital to others in Illinois. The national average is 72% in that category.

Timely and effective care in hospital emergency departments is an essential element for good patient outcomes. Delays before receiving medical care in the emergency department is one of several reasons that patients suffer increased risks for serious illnesses and injuries. Waiting times are different at hospitals and those times vary widely. The length of time a patient may wait at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center depends on staffing levels, time of day, admitting procedures or the availability of inpatient beds. 51 minutes is the average time patients who came to the emergency department at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center waited with broken bones before getting pain medication. The Illinois average is 49 minutes. Only 1% of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center’s patients who came to the emergency department left before being seen or treated. The Illinois average is 3% with the national average being 2%. The average time patients spent in the emergency department before they were admitted to the hospital as an inpatient at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center was 322 minutes compared to the national average of 295 minutes and the Illinois average of 301.5 minutes. The data for this item was submitted based on a sample of cases/patients.

93% of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center’s patients were assessed and given the appropriate influenza vaccine. The Illinois and national averages are both 94%. In the same category of preventative medicine, healthcare workers at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center were given flu vaccines at the rate of 94%. The Illinois average is 87%.

The deaths among patients with serious treatable complications after surgery at Advocate Illinois Masonic Medical Center was no different than the national rate at 136.48 per 1,000 patient discharges.
